DJ China Jiangxi Copper Settles 2010 Copper TC/RCs With Freeport

iconJan 4, 2010 15:52


SHANGHAI, Jan 04, 2010 (Dow Jones Commodities News via Comtex) -- China's Jiangxi Copper Co. (0358.HK) has settled 2010 copper treatment and refining charges with Freeport McMoRan Copper & Gold Inc. (FCX) at $46.50 a metric ton and 4.65 cents a pound, a person familiar with the matter said Monday.


"Jiangxi Copper has signed the agreement (for 2010) with Freeport, given ($46.5/ton) has become a benchmark in the industry," the person said.

Jiangxi Copper is China's largest copper smelter by output and aims to produce 900,000 tons of refined copper in 2010.
